Virginia: Required Human Trafficking Training for Hotel Employees
Effective January 1, 2023, hotel proprietors must provide training to their employees so they can recognize and report human trafficking. The training will be provided by the Department of Criminal Justice Services, or approved by it, and offered online or in-person. Each hotel employee must complete the training within six months of hire and then at least once every two years.
